Choosing the Right Ingredients
Making a latte might seem like a simple task, but using the right ingredients can make all the difference. Here are some tips for choosing the best ingredients for your homemade latte.
1. Coffee Beans
The key to a great latte is using high-quality coffee beans. Look for beans that are freshly roasted and have a smooth, rich flavor. You can choose between light, medium, or dark roast depending on your preference. If possible, buy whole bean coffee and grind it just before making your latte for maximum freshness and flavor.
2. Milk
Milk is an essential ingredient for making a latte. The best milk for lattes is whole milk, which has a higher fat content and helps create a creamy texture. If you’re lactose intolerant or prefer a non-dairy option, you can also use soy, almond, or oat milk.
3. Sweetener
If you prefer your latte sweet, you can add a sweetener like sugar, honey, or syrup. However, keep in mind that adding too much sweetener can overpower the flavor of the coffee and milk. Start with a small amount and adjust to your liking.
Tools You’ll Need
Before you start making your latte, you’ll need to gather some tools. Here are the necessary tools you’ll need to make a latte at home.
1. Espresso Machine
The first and most crucial tool you’ll need to make a latte is an espresso machine. There are many types of espresso machines available, from manual to fully automatic. You don’t need to spend a fortune, just look for a machine that can make a decent shot of espresso.
2. Milk Frother
A milk frother is another essential tool for making a latte. It helps create the creamy texture of the milk and enhances the overall flavor of the latte. There are two types of milk frothers: handheld and automatic. Handheld frothers are inexpensive and easy to use, while automatic frothers are more expensive but produce better results.
3. Tamper
A tamper is a small tool that is used to press the coffee grounds into the espresso machine’s portafilter. It helps create a more consistent shot of espresso and enhances the flavor of the coffee.
Steps to Make a Latte
Now that you have your ingredients and tools ready, it’s time to start making your latte. Here are the steps to follow to make a great latte at home.
1. Prepare the Espresso Shot
Start by preparing a shot of espresso using your espresso machine. Follow the instructions of your machine and make sure to use the right amount of coffee grounds.
2. Froth the Milk
While your espresso is brewing, froth your milk using the milk frother. Make sure to heat the milk to the right temperature, which is around 150°F.
3. Combine the Milk and Espresso
Once your espresso shot is ready, pour it into a cup. Then, pour the frothed milk into the cup, holding back the foam with a spoon. Slowly add the foam on top of the milk.
4. Add Sweetener (Optional)
If you prefer a sweeter latte, add your desired sweetener to the latte while stirring continuously.
5. Enjoy your Homemade Latte!
Finally, sit back and enjoy your homemade latte. Add some cocoa powder or cinnamon on top for some extra flavor.

Frothing the Milk
The next step is frothing the milk which is an important component of a latte and adds the signature creamy texture to the drink. Here are the steps for frothing milk:
- If you have an electric milk frother, pour cold milk into the frother and turn it on. It will automatically heat and froth the milk to the desired temperature.
- If using a stovetop, pour cold milk into a saucepan and heat it until it starts to steam. Then whisk it vigorously until it forms a creamy froth.
- Make sure not to overheat the milk as it can affect the taste and texture, and can even burn the milk.

Steps for Making Latte at Home
Now that you have gathered all the ingredients and have an espresso machine let’s move on to the next step, which is making latte. Here are some basic steps that you need to follow:
- Brew one or two shots of espresso in a proper espresso machine and preheat the mug.
- Measure one cup of milk and add it to a milk pitcher.
- Steam the milk until it reaches the correct temperature, which is between 140-160℉. You can use a thermometer to check the temperature.
- Add sugar or honey to the espresso and stir it well.
- Pour the steamed milk slowly into the mug containing espresso shot while holding back the foam with a spoon.
- Pour the frothy milk over the top of milk and the espresso, creating latte art if desired.
- Sprinkle some cinnamon on the top and enjoy your delicious homemade latte.
Tips to Make the Perfect Latte
Now that you know the basic steps let’s discover some useful tip, which will help you make a perfect latte.
- Use full-fat milk is better for making latte than non-fat milk
- The milk pitcher should be filled halfway to allow space for froth to form.
- Make sure your coffee and milk are of good quality and fresh
- Don’t overheat the milk because it can ruin the flavour and texture.
- You can practice pouring the milk, creating latte art to make your latte more attractive.
